Boars-hair brush

I've never used one but I've read that boars hair is pricey but is supposed to be great for car washing since it's very soft and won't easily trap dirt... I'm having trouble locating places that sell them (local and on the Net).

Can anyone recommend a place to get one or throw in their .02 if they're worth the expense?
